This HAZWOPER training course is designed to create awareness to hazards that may be present when working at a hazardous waste cleanup site or responding to an emergency release.

- After completing this course, learners will be able to:
- Describe measures that can be taken to prevent injury and illness including controlling hazards and placing importance on thinking safety first
- List chemical hazards (including both health and physical hazards from chemicals), signs and symptoms of exposure, and precautions that can be taken
- Discuss other health hazards to be aware of like radiation, biological hazards, heat stress, cold temperatures, ergonomic issues, noise, and possible psychological impacts
- Recognize other physical hazards including electrical hazards, confined spaces, equipment and tool hazards, falling objects, weather-related hazards, and other site safety hazards
- Intended Audience: Any employees who may be involved or expected to engage in:
- Hazardous waste cleanup operations where the employee may be exposed to hazardous substances; or
- A response to an occurrence which results, or is likely to result, in an uncontrolled release of a hazardous substance
- Regs Covered: 29 CFR 1910.120, 29 CFR 1926.65, 29 CFR 1910.1096, 29 CFR 1910.137, & 29 CFR 1910.146
